Catherine Gaines was born in 1758 in King and Queen Co., Virginia, the child of Henry Gaines And Ann George. Catherine Gaines married Richard Waggoner, and had children including Elizabeth Waggoner, James Waggoner, Martin Waggoner, Mary Polly Waggoner, Richard W Waggener, Susannah Waggoner, Thomas Waggoner. Catherine Gaines passed away in 1817 in Barren Co Kentucky.
